Terms Used In Delaware Code > Title 19 > Chapter 16 > Subchapter II - Volunteer Firefighter and Rescue Squad Worker Protection Act [Effective upon enactment of comparable federal law]

  • Attorney: as used in this chapter , refers to the attorney-in-fact of a reciprocal insurer. See Delaware Code Title 18 Sec. 5705
  • Contract: A legal written agreement that becomes binding when signed.
  • Corporation: A legal entity owned by the holders of shares of stock that have been issued, and that can own, receive, and transfer property, and carry on business in its own name.
  • employee: means any police officer or firefighter employed by a public employer except those determined by the Board to be inappropriate for inclusion in the bargaining unit; provided, however, that for the purposes of this chapter with respect to any state employee covered under the State Merit System, position classification, health care and other benefit programs established pursuant to Chapters 52 and 96 of Title 29, workers' compensation, disability programs and pension programs shall not be deemed to be compensation. See Delaware Code Title 19 Sec. 1602
  • employer: includes the Town of Delmar, Delaware. See Delaware Code Title 19 Sec. 1602
  • Power of attorney: A written instrument which authorizes one person to act as another's agent or attorney. The power of attorney may be for a definite, specific act, or it may be general in nature. The terms of the written power of attorney may specify when it will expire. If not, the power of attorney usually expires when the person granting it dies. Source: OCC
  • State: means the State of Delaware; and when applied to different parts of the United States, it includes the District of Columbia and the several territories and possessions of the United States. See Delaware Code Title 1 Sec. 302
  • Trustee: A person or institution holding and administering property in trust.
